Sabaragamuwa’s sweet revenge ends Japura’s SLUG netball reign

The Interuniversity Netball Championship of the 15th Sri Lanka University Games was concluded successfully at the Rajarata University Sports Grounds recently. The tournament was brought to life with the participation of all (16) state-owned universities, and the event saw some thrilling games with nail-biting finishes for over a week’s time. At the end of the tournament, Sabaragamuwa girls showcased their grit and grace to clinch the championship glory by defeating the defending champions from J’pura.

In the preliminary round of the tournament, the teams were drawn into four groups as follows.

Group A – University of Sri Jayawardhanepura, Jaffna University, Eastern University, University of Vavuniya

 

Group B – Sabaragamuwa University, Wayamba University, South Eastern University, University of the Visual and Performing Arts (VPA)

 

Group C – University of Peradeniya, University of Moratuwa, Rajarata University, University of Ruhuna

 

Group D – University of Kelaniya, Gampaha Wickramarachchi University of Indigenous Medicine, University of Colombo, Uva Wellassa University

In the preliminary round, the University of Sri Jayawardhanepura, Sabaragamuwa University, the University of Kelaniya and the University of Moratuwa stayed unbeaten and marched into the quarterfinals as the group tops. Along with them, the University of Peradeniya, the University of Colombo, Wayamba University and Jaffna University also secured their places in the next round by being the runners-up of each group.

In the quarterfinals, the University of Sri Jayawardhanepura, Sabaragamuwa University and the University of Kelaniya continued their fine rhythm with an unbeaten streak to advance into the semifinals. Meanwhile, the lasses from Jaffna University stunned the unbeaten and one of the tournament favourites, the University of Moratuwa, by shattering the tournament predictions.

In the semifinals, last year’s finalists, the University of Sri Jayawardhanepura and Sabaragamuwa University, cruised into the final, leaving room for another exciting battle. During the final, the determined J’pura ladies showcased a spirited performance as the defending champions, but the lasses from Sabaragamuwa resisted well and were in search of revenge for last year’s defeat. During this intense battle the finest level of competition was laid in every pass, every shoot, and every defence. Finally, the Sabaragamuwa ladies had the last laugh as they managed to edge out the defending champions to rewrite history.

This breakthrough victory is a testament to the leadership of their captain and the senior player Ishara Sewwandi, while Sadisna Ranasinghe also contributed remarkably as the vice captain. The champion side trained under the watchful eyes of the head coach, Malindu Yasmitha, and Akila Vidanage (assistant coach and trainer).

Preliminary Round Results

  • University of Sri Jayawardhanepura 28 – 22 Jaffna University
  • University of Sri Jayawardhanepura  50 – 08 Eastern University
  • University of Sri Jayawardhanepura 51 – 01 University of Vavuniya
  • Eastern University 07 – 32 Jaffna University
  • University of Vavuniya 02 – 53 Jaffna University
  • Eastern University beat University of Vavuniya

  • Sabaragamuwa University 64 – 04 VPA
  • Sabaragamuwa University 72 – 03 South Eastern University
  • Sabaragamuwa University 50 – 13 Wayamba University
  • VPA beat South Eastern University
  • Wayamba University beat South Eastern University
  • Wayamba University beat VPA

 

  • University of Moratuwa 28 – 21 Rajarata University
  • University of Peradeniya 32 – 11 University of Ruhuna
  • University of Peradeniya 38 – 22 Rajarata University
  • University of Moratuwa 26 – 26 University of Peradeniya
  • (University of Moratuwa won after extra time 35 – 34)
  • Rajarata University 29 – 24 University of Ruhuna
  • University of Moratuwa beat University of Ruhuna

 

  • Uva Wellassa University 39 08 Gampaha Wickramarachchi University
  • University of Colombo 34 18 Uva Wellassa University
  • University of Kelaniya 58 07 Gampaha Wickramarachchi University
  • University of Kelaniya 31 29 University of Colombo
  • University of Kelaniya beat Uva Wellassa University
  • University of Colombo beat Gampaha Wickramarachchi University

Quarter Finals

  • University of Sri Jayawardhanepura 30 – 24 University of Peradeniya
  • Sabaragamuwa University 46 – 29 University of Colombo
  • University of Kelaniya beat Wayamba University
  • University of Jaffna beat University of Moratuwa

Semifinals

  • University of Sri Jayawardhanepura 40 – 18 University of Kelaniya
  • Sabaragamuwa University 36 – 26 University of Jaffna

Third place

  • University of Jaffna beat University of Kelaniya

The Final

  • University of Sri Jayawardhanepura 52 – 58 Sabaragamuwa University

The Champions - Sabaragamuwa University

1st Runners-up - University of Sri Jayawardhanepura

2nd runners-up - University of Jaffna

3rd  runners-up - University of Kelaniya
